找到 2047 篇文章 关于操作系统

如何在 Linux 中替换大型单行文本文件中的字符串?

Satish Kumar
更新于 2022-12-01 08:48:10

866 次浏览

某些软件在处理输入文件之前会将其完整内容加载到内存中。如果输入文件包含非常长的字符串,则如果内存不足以容纳整个字符串,软件可能会崩溃。我们将探讨在 Linux 中更改大型单行文件中的单个字符的方法。某些应用程序无法处理非常大的单行文件,因此我们将检查我们的选项。目标文件一些现代 JavaScript 框架将所有代码压缩到一个语句中。假设我们有一个名为 original.js 的 JavaScript 代码单行文件,其中存在错误。它调用“fliter”而不是 ... 阅读更多

如何在 Linux 上从 GitHub 下载 Tarball?

Satish Kumar
更新于 2022-12-01 08:44:37

3K+ 次浏览

Github 是一个用于开源项目的在线源代码存储库和托管服务,它提供了托管、版本控制、审查、分支和提交对托管在该服务上的任何项目更改的功能。以下步骤将帮助您从 github.com 下载您选择的 tarball:通过使用 git clone 将 Git 存储库下载为 tar 或 zip 文件您可以使用命令行工具“Github”(默认安装)或 GUI 客户端“SourceTree”。但是,如果您没有这些工具,则可以下载 tar 格式的源代码并提取其内容 ... 阅读更多

如何获取 Linux 命令的路径?

Satish Kumar
更新于 2022-12-01 08:41:43

4K+ 次浏览

您从终端窗口运行的 Linux 命令可以是内置的(系统的一部分)、函数(输入某些命令时运行的应用程序)、别名(命令的另一个名称)或外部可执行文件(您下载的程序)。您可以使用 which、command、whereis、whatis 和 type 工具来确定每个命令是什么以及它们位于何处。我们将查看 which、command、types 和 whereis 命令,因为它们通常存在于大多数基于 Linux 的操作系统中。因此,让我们探讨如何在 ... 阅读更多

如何在 Bash 中合并 PDF 文件?

Vishesh Kumar
更新于 2022-11-21 10:21:51

548 次浏览

简介在各种情况下,我们希望合并 PDF 文件以组织它们、减少混乱或与他人共享。Linux 提供了多种用于合并 pdf 文件的实用程序。以下列出了一些最流行的:pdfunite pdftk gs convert qpdf这些应用程序工具具有许多功能,并且对于本文,我们将重点关注其文件合并功能。让我们分别检查其中的一些。pdfunite“pdfunite”是 Poppler Utils 包中用于合并 PDF 文件的工具的名称。pdfunite 的使用非常简单。使用以下 DNF 命令 ... 阅读更多

如何将标准输出带颜色地写入文件?

Vishesh Kumar
更新于 2022-11-21 10:20:02

752 次浏览

简介本文将介绍我们可以用来将标准输出发送到文件同时保持其颜色的工具。这在故障排除时特别有用,因为它使彩色区域更容易扫描输出日志。通过使用 Grep可以使用 grep 命令搜索文件中的文本模式或字符串。模式的名称是正则表达式。语法grep 命令的语法如下所示:$ grep [选项] 模式 [文件]示例让我们制作一个 example.txt 文件,使用 cat 命令。之后我们将 ... 阅读更多

如何在 Linux 命令行中交换两个文件?

Vishesh Kumar
更新于 2022-11-21 10:17:04

1K+ 次浏览

作为系统管理员或 DevOps 功能,很多时候我们都会遇到交换文件内容的要求,例如,假设您有一个名为 /etc/password.backup 的 /etc/passwd 的备份文件,并且您希望将其还原到 /etc/passwd 中,但您也希望将 /etc/passwd 的当前内容复制到 /etc/passwd.backup 中。换句话说,交换 /etc/passwd 和 /etc/passwd.backup 的内容,以及 /etc/passwd.backup 和 /etc/passwd 的内容。Linux 操作系统的有用工具和命令使您能够实现/完成各种文件操作目标。由于某种原因,您可能需要在 Linux 中交换两个文件 ... 阅读更多

如何使用 openssl 加密大型文件?

Vishesh Kumar
更新于 2022-11-21 10:15:16

1K+ 次浏览

OpenSSL OpenSSL 是一种用于通用加密和安全通信的宝贵工具,它执行各种任务,包括加密文件。大多数 Linux 发行版默认安装该设备;如果没有,您可以使用您的包管理器安装它。在使用 OpenSSL 加密文件之前,让我们对加密有一个基本的了解。加密是一种对消息进行编码以保护其内容免受窥探的方法。一般来说,有两种类型:对称或秘密密钥加密非对称或公钥加密秘密密钥加密使用相同的密钥进行加密和解密,而公钥加密使用单独的密钥 ... 阅读更多

如何在 Linux 中在文件的每一行之后添加字符串?

Vishesh Kumar
更新于 2022-11-21 10:08:33

2K+ 次浏览

简介我们有时需要快速更改文件,最好是从命令行进行。一个例子是在文件的每一行末尾添加一个字符串。在本文中,我们将探讨使用各种 Linux 命令来实现此目的的几种方法。本文中将始终使用以下示例文件 language.txt:pi@TTP:~ $ touch language.txt示例将创建一个名为 language.txt 的文件。pi@TTP:~ $ cat > language.txt借助 cat 命令和 >,我们可以将数据插入文件。如果我们打开文件 language.txt,您 ... 阅读更多

如何在 Linux 中查找打开的端口?

Vishesh Kumar
更新于 2022-11-21 09:54:12

837 次浏览

在解释如何在 Linux 中列出所有打开的网络端口之前,我们将简要讨论计算机网络中的端口。在计算机网络和软件术语中,端口是表示网络应用程序的逻辑实体。端口是一个用于通过数字识别网络服务的术语。端口充当 Linux 操作系统识别特定进程或应用程序的通信端点。端口是一个 16 位(0 到 65535)数字,用于区分一个正在运行的网络应用程序与其他应用程序。我们可以将这些端口号分为三类,知名端口(0 到 1023) ... 阅读更多

Docker 容器网络命名空间不可见

Vishesh Kumar
更新于 2022-11-21 09:50:49

576 次浏览

本文将探讨 Docker 容器中网络命名空间文件的问题。我们将检查为什么网络命名空间文件对 ip netns ls 命令不可见。在继续之前,让我们简要概述一下 Docker、容器和网络命名空间容器化容器化类似于虚拟化,其中应用程序及其所有依赖项和库都打包到单个容器中;它可以在任何计算环境中运行。当操作系统内核和所有必要的库和依赖项都包含在容器中时,任何处理该应用程序的人都可以仅使用该容器来 ... 阅读更多

广告